    Antipasta with blue cheese dressing
    Kim L.

    Delivery order of a cheese pizza and antipasta -very quick and excellent quality. Good size for an 8 cut. We asked for crispy and it was. The antipasta was large and really full of meat and cheese. Also nice they include artichoke hearts and roasted red peppers. Their blue cheese dressing is excellent.

    Deborah H.

    On vacation in Schenectady NY and decided on DeMarco's Pizza because it was so close to our campground. In an older part of town, we parked on the street. A small pizza place, looks like the building was an old store at one time many decades ago. A carry out and if you want you can dine in at one of their tables. Very clean and organized considering its size. You check out the menu and order at the counter. Large cooler with ample choice's of beverages and 4 large already made pizzas, all different to choose from if you wanted a quick lunch or to take home a few slices. We placed our order with a very nice young woman at the counter. Sat at a table to wait for our dinner order to be brought to us. Steady stream of customers coming in to pick up their carry out orders and no doubt popular with the locals! Our Caesar salad was brought to us first with really good Italian bread and butter. That salad was huge and chilled and fresh with a great dressing and tasty croutons and ample shaved Parmesan cheese, it was delish, had some leftovers for home. Then that awesome, hot, delicious large Meat lovers cooked well down pizza arrived and it was piping hot and we wanted to jump in but had to wait for it to cool down a few minutes, then we dug in!! OMG, one of the best pizzas we have had the pleasure of eating, bar none!!! The pizza was delicious and the sauce and cheese perfect. Ample toppings and lots of cheese, we truly enjoyed our meal and had some to take home. Prices so reasonable for the Soda's, salad and that big pizza. You must try this place, highly recommend!! DeMarco's pizza has a cult following and my husband and I just joined the club! Debbie, Mich

    Loretta H.

    A friend of mine boasted of the wonderful Antipasto she got from Demarco's in Scotia. So, while I was in the neighborhood one day, I picked up one said salad to go. It was everything she said it was. A fresh bed of lettuce and greens topped with mounds of salami, ham, pepperoni and cheese along with red onions, peppers, pepperoncinis, and I can't remember the rest. It's not near me to visit regularly, but would if it were closer. Those who live near here I am sure they know of the great place they have.

    I've always wanted to visit More Perreca's on Jay St. I've heard so much about the restaurant and…read moreespecially the bakery, Perreca's, located right next door. The businesses are located a couple of blocks from the gateway marking the entrance to Schenectady's Little Italy. So much history, food and romance in this neighborhood. We had Sunday brunch at More Perreca's. The bakery is closed on Sunday but I got a Sausage Lettuce Tomato sandwich served on toasted Perreca's bread. It was so delish. The Italian sausage was served with lettuce, tomato, roasted garlic puree, mayo and side salad. Everything was so fresh. My $11 meal was reasonably priced. The garlic purée was amazing. They need to bottle it. I'd buy some. My friend had the Mac and cheese and an espresso martini. He loved both. Rachelle was our server. She was wonderful. Very helpful. She explained some of the menu to me because there were a number of Italian sausage dishes. The food was prepared quickly which was great because we were hungry. Rachelle came back later to check on us. I gave her a thumbs up and a smile while busily chewing a bite of sandwich. The restaurant is charming with nice tin ceilings and big windows to let the light in. There are many booths which makes it cozy. When we arrived most of the tables were full. Based on the chatter in the room it sounded as though a lot of friends had gathered at the restaurant to literally break bread over brunch. The menu offers a nice variety: from egg breakfasts, assorted salads to Italian classics. It was an all around yummy and enjoyable experience. I let Rachelle know that we'll be coming back.

    My family, party of six, had lunch here Thursday 2/26/26. It was Downtown Schenectady Resturant…read moreWeek. Three course lunch $20-choice of 3 apps, 3 entrees, & 2 desserts. A great value! Our server, Rachelle M. was great! My app was garlic parm wings that were tasty & crispy-perfect. Three of us had the eggs in purgatory- 3 eggs cooked in a spicy marinara sauce w/ 4 pieces of toasted Perreca's famous Italian bread. Highly recommend this dish that's always on their menu. Others had the very good eggplant rollatini over spaghetti. The original coal-fired bakery is next door offering their signature crusty bread, red tomato pie, cheeses, meatballs, salamis, soppersottas, olives, giant cupcakes, & cannolli. Located in Schenectady's Little Italy. Restaurant hours: Sun, Wed, Thursday 11am-7pm, Fri & Sat 10am-8pm, closed Mon & Tue. More's Perreca's never disappoints. Beer, wine, & cocktails served so try here for brunch too. Thank you, Rachelle & staff. We had a great time. Nick & Liz, Albany, NY, USA
